How do you know if you have an infection vs. test flu?
Infections usually are slightly different. When you have an infection the sight of the infection would be more tender then normal, red, sometimes discharge, and very warm as if you had a fever on that one spot. Also they can turn into a boil do to a staff infection which sucks ass! You will be able to tell usually the infection is on pin sight vs the test flu effects your whole body but dont get me wrong an infection can effect more then just the area you pinned in more severe cases.
